触控面板中感测电容值的调整方法及调整装置

申请公布号:TWI503729

申请号:TW103114345

申请日期:2014.04.21

申请公布日期:2015.10.11

申请人:
世环国际股份有限公司

发明人:戴正杰;黄启斌

分类号:G06F3/044

主分类号:G06F3/044

代理人:赖安国 台北市信义区东兴路37号9楼;王立成 台北市信义区东兴路37号9楼

地址:台北市内湖区基湖路10巷57号4楼之1

主权项:一种触控面板中感测电容值的调整方法,系用于预设定该触控面板之触控感测器内用来感测触控讯号之感测通道的电容值,以产生供该触控面板之控制器于运作时的调整依据,该设定调整方法包含:电容变异量取得步骤,系于该触控面板上之复数个第一方向感测通道及复数个第二方向感测通道中,选取同方向感测通道上之相邻两感测通道,进行无外在触控行为下之该两感测通道间电容值的感测,以取得一电容值变异量;平衡电容值变异的估算步骤,系使用所选取之通道所属的触控感测器,并藉由该触控感测器之复数调整通道上各别连接的调整电容器进行所需电容调整值的估算以产生一调整配置,该调整配置系用于使该触控感测器之各该调整通道上所连接的调整电容器施加至该两感测通道的至少其一,以平衡电容值的变异程度;调整配置表建立步骤,系储存该触控面板内同方向感测通道上之相邻两感测通道所需的各个调整配置以产生一调整配置表,供该触控面板之控制器使用;及一外接调整电容器的设定步骤,系根据一预设基础电容调整值设定每一触控感测器所配置之调整电容器,其中该预设基础电容调整值系为预设的最小可调整值,该外接调整电容器的设定步骤包含:于该预设基础电容调整值大于调整通道电容值的情况下,系依”电容值=(3R-1)N-M,其中R为1至x的正整数,N为该预设基 础电容调整值,M为第R感测通道的调整通道电容值”的规则配置每一触控感测器之该等调整通道中第x个调整通道对应连接的调整电容器。
